Market Sizing, Growth Estimates, and CAGR Projections

Based on recent industry data, the South Korea natural grape seed extract market was valued at approximately USD 120 million in 2023. This valuation considers the rising demand for plant-based antioxidants, functional ingredients, and natural health supplements. Assuming a conservative comp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.5% over the next five years, driven by increasing health awareness and expanding application scopes, the market is projected to reach approximately USD 180 million by 2028.

Key assumptions underpinning these projections include:

  • Steady growth in health-conscious consumer segments, particularly among middle-aged and elderly demographics.
  • Enhanced regulatory support for natural and organic ingredients, fostering product innovation.
  • Technological advancements reducing extraction costs and improving yield efficiencies.
  • Growing export opportunities within Asia-Pacific and to Western markets, facilitated by trade agreements and quality certifications.

Value Chain and Lifecycle Analysis

The value chain encompasses:

  1. Raw Material Sourcing:

    Grape seeds sourced predominantly from local vineyards, with quality control measures ensuring high polyphenol content and contaminant-free raw material.

  2. Extraction & Processing:

    Utilization of green extraction technologies such as supercritical CO2, enzymatic hydrolysis, and ultrasound-assisted extraction to maximize yield and purity.

  3. Manufacturing & Standardization:

    Concentration, drying, encapsulation, and formulation processes tailored to end-user specifications, with rigorous quality control protocols aligned with ISO and GMP standards.

  4. Distribution & Logistics:

    Multi-channel distribution including direct sales, online platforms, and third-party distributors, with a focus on maintaining product integrity during transit.

  5. End-User Delivery & Application:

    Final products integrated into dietary supplements, functional foods, beverages, and cosmeceuticals, with lifecycle services including technical support and regulatory guidance.

The revenue model emphasizes high-margin specialty extracts, licensing fees, and value-added services such as custom formulation and stability testing.

Cost Structures, Pricing Strategies, and Risk Factors

Major cost components include raw material procurement (~30%), extraction and processing (~25%), quality assurance (~10%), logistics (~10%), and R&D (~15%). Operating margins are typically in the 15–20% range, with premium pricing for standardized, high-potency extracts.

Pricing strategies focus on value-based pricing, emphasizing product purity, bioavailability, and certification credentials. Volume discounts and long-term supply agreements are common to secure market share.

Key risk factors encompass:

  • Regulatory Challenges:

    Variability in standards across regions, potential for ingredient bans, and evolving compliance requirements.

  • Cybersecurity Concerns:

    Data breaches impacting supply chain integrity and proprietary formulations.

  • Supply Chain Disruptions:

    Dependence on agricultural raw materials susceptible to climate change and geopolitical factors.

  • Market Volatility:

    Fluctuations in raw material prices and consumer demand shifts.
